Year 11 Christian Service

Sharing Gifts 2022

 

Last week all Year 11 students were sent out into the community over four days to give service to others. Some of our young men were placed in Aged Care, which was a rare opportunity in these COVID times. The impact it had on them and the people they cared for was very evident when I had the opportunity to visit them during the week. Also comments from staff about our students were very heartwarming. 

 

“On behalf of the resident and staff of Little Sisters of The Poor, we would like to send our thanks and compliments to the boys (Edward, Kaleb, Trent and Fraser) who attended last week for their Christian Service. At all times the students were polite, respectful, helpful, well-mannered, and kind. The residents enjoyed their time together and the boys were all good sports when interacting with the residents in social activities.” 

 

Many other students were placed in Charity Stores this year which required involvement in some rather repetitive tasks but also interaction with a lively group of staff and volunteers who were so welcoming and appreciative of our student’s assistance.

 

I just want to thank you for Lachlan and Leon. They were an absolute pleasure to have here. They both adapted so well and were so polite, they are both welcome back here any time.

 

I just wanted to let you know that Justin and Finn arrived early with a professional approach, dressed appropriately, and have represented Trinity College brilliantly. I am so impressed by their customer focus, enthusiasm towards all tasks and mature behaviour.” 

 

Students who were placed in Primary Schools also made an excellent impact on the schools they were working in, some through tireless work in the gardens, others assisting teachers with a myriad of jobs and helping children with class work but most of all enjoying having fun with younger children at breaks.

 

The challenge and reward of working with children with disabilities, was offered to a few students who were a real help to the places where they gave service. They also expressed how much they enjoyed the experience and appreciated what they had learnt from their time in these special schools.

 

Thank you to all the staff who visited students at their placements during the week and gave feedback about the student’s experience. Unfortunately, there were quite a few students, who because of sickness, could not participate fully in the week of Christian Service and Mr Oliver and I will be providing an opportunity at the end of the year for students to have some experience of the program.
